Where Mortgage Lenders in Benton County, AR Serve

Benton County, located in the northwest corner of Arkansas, boasts a plethora of landmarks that are sure to fascinate any visitor. From the stunning Crystal Bridges Museum of American Art to the historic Peel Mansion Museum and Heritage Gardens, there is no shortage of cultural and historical sites to explore. Additionally, the county is home to the beautiful Beaver Lake, which offers ample opportunities for outdoor recreation. In terms of top employers, Benton County is a hub of economic activity, with major companies such as Walmart, Tyson Foods, and J.B. Hunt Transport Services all headquartered in the area. Other significant employers include the University of Arkansas and Mercy Hospital Northwest Arkansas. The county is also crisscrossed by several major highways and streets, including Interstate 49, U.S. Route 62, and Arkansas Highway 12.
